General description
Phosphorus triiodide (PI3) is a trihalide of phosphorus that can be used as a deactivator and a deoxygenating agent.
Application
PI3 is used in the synthesis of black phosphate crystal, which can be used as a semiconducting material for optoelectronic applications. It is also a source of triiodide that can be utilized as a charge carrier in electrolytes for dye sensitized solar cells.
